  • Patent number: 7005877
    Abstract: The present invention is to provide a burn-in adapter comprising a first connector, an interface circuit (e.g., RS-232 port), a jumper assembly, a reset instruction generator, and a second connector coupled to a motherboard, in which the interface circuit is electrically coupled to the first connector, the jumper assembly, the reset instruction generator, and the second connector respectively, different signal levels are generated by moving or removing a plurality of jumpers of the jumper assembly, the first connector is electrically coupled to a burn-in device via a first cable, and the second connector is electrically coupled to the motherboard via a second cable, thereby the burn-in adapter is adapted to burn a memory of the motherboard after generating a reset instruction and a burn-in signal level to cause the motherboard entering into a burn-in state.
    Type: Grant
    Filed: July 13, 2004
    Date of Patent: February 28, 2006
    Assignee: Inventec Corporation
    Inventors: Ying-Chuan Tsai, Yi-Lin Chiang
  • Publication number: 20060023560
    Abstract: The present invention relates to a structure for directly burning a program into a motherboard comprising a burning plate having a series connected first transistor set, a resistor, a comparator and a series connected second transistor set mounted thereon, wherein the first transistor set, the resistor, and comparator are series connected, two input terminals of the first transistor set and an output terminal of the comparator are electrically connected to a burner, an output terminal of the first transistor set is coupled to a serial data pin of a memory on the motherboard, an input terminal of the second transistor set is electrically connected to the burner, and an output terminal of the second transistor set is coupled to a serial clock pin of the memory for directly burning the program into the memory and checking the program burned therein.
    Type: Application
    Filed: July 28, 2004
    Publication date: February 2, 2006
    Applicant: INVENTEC COPORATION
    Inventor: Ying-Chuan Tsai

  • Publication number: 20050010650
    Abstract: A network-based computer platform external access method and system is proposed, which is designed for use with a computer platform, especially with an I/O-unequipped computer platform, such as a network server, for the externally controlling the operations of the I/O-unequipped computer platform and monitoring responses from the same. The proposed method and system normally allows the user to gain access to the I/O-unequipped computer platform either in manual mode or auto mode. In auto mode, it allows the user to perform an externally-monitored auto test procedure on the I/O-unequipped computer platform by downloading a test-procedure description file via a network system from a server to test the internal hardware/software configurations of the I/O-unequipped computer platform. These features allow-the network system management personnel to perform network management tasks on the I/O-unequipped network server more conveniently and efficiently.
    Type: Application
    Filed: July 11, 2003
    Publication date: January 13, 2005
    Inventor: Ying-Chuan Tsai
